  Collective bargaining - Wikipedia, the free encyclopedia
Other writers have emphasised the conflict resolution aspects of collective bargaining, but in Britain the most important refinement was that made by Allan Flanders, who defined it as a process of rule-making, leading to joint regulation in industry.
In Britain collective bargaining has been, and has been endorsed as, the dominant and most appropriate means of regulating workers' terms and conditions of employment, in line with ILO Convention No. 84 for many years.
However, the importance of collective bargaining in Britain and elsewhere in the industrialized world has been declining considerably since the early 1980s.

 Encyclopedia: Collective bargaining agreement
The Collective Bargaining Agreement (CBA) is the contract between the NHL and the NHLPA that defines the structure of procedural, financial, and disciplinary relationships between the NHL, its teams, and its players.
The current CBA is set to expire on September 15, 2004.
Disagreements and difficulties in negotiations with the NHLPA has raised the possibility of a lockout in the 2004-2005 season if a new agreement is not reached in time.

 NHL CBA
The CBA is six years in duration (through the 2010-11 season) with the NHLPA having the option to re-open the agreement after Year Four (after the 2008-09 season).
Under the new CBA, Restricted Free Agents who do not sign contracts by December 1 of a given year will be ineligible to play in the League for the balance of that season.
Per the agreement, every NHL player will be subject to up to two "no-notice" tests every year, with at least one such test to be conducted on a team-wide basis.

 NBA Salary Cap FAQ
The CBA defines the salary cap, the procedures for determining how it is set, the minimum and maximum salaries, the rules for trades, the procedures for the NBA draft, and a hundred other things that need to be defined in order for a league like the NBA to function.
The current CBA has been in effect since January 1999, and was arrived at after a long and bitter "lockout" which cost half of the 1998-99 season.

 "Agreement, Collective Bargaining" Defined
AGREEMENT, COLLECTIVE BARGAINING - An agreement negotiated between a labor union and an employer that sets forth the terms of employment for the employees who are members of that labor union.
This type of agreement may include provisions concerning wages, vacation time, working hours, working conditions, and health insurance benefits.
Some types of collective bargaining are regulated by various labor laws and regulations.

 NBA Collective Bargaining Agreement Signed
The NBA's new collective bargaining agreement was finally completed and signed early Saturday, clearing the way for free agent signings to begin Tuesday.
Lawyers for the league and the players' union had been working nearly around the clock for the past several days on drafting the documents for the six-year agreement, which was agreed to in principle more than a month ago.
League attorneys will spend the next few days reviewing the agreement with teams, and signings will begin at noon EDT on Tuesday.
